What are the signs of a dirty chimney?

You might see black soot around your fireplace. A smoky smell when you use your fireplace is another sign. You may also notice creosote buildup on the inside of your chimney walls. These are all indicators that your Virginia chimney needs a cleaning.

What does a chimney sweep do?

A chimney sweep cleans out soot and creosote from your chimney. We inspect for damage and blockages. This ensures your chimney vents properly and safely. Our service helps prevent chimney fires and keeps your home safe, especially during Virginia winters.

Can I sweep my chimney myself?

While some people try DIY chimney cleaning, it's often best left to professionals. You need specialized tools and knowledge to do it safely and effectively. Our sweeps in Virginia have the training to do the job right.

How often should you have a chimney sweep done?

For most Virginia homes, we recommend an annual chimney sweep. This is especially true if you use your fireplace regularly. Regular cleaning by a Virginia sweep prevents dangerous buildup and ensures your system is safe.
